Share buybacks have skyrocketed because interest rates remain low and companies are having a very hard time finding alternative profitable investments. At the price of some of these stocks, it is a huge waste of money. The market wouldn't be at this level if the federal government didn't incur record deficits in the trillions for two years straight.
The Fed is complicit insofar as they have been enablers of this reckless spending by monetizing all that debt for the government. Their purchases of T-bonds has kept the rates nice and low.
The market won't be at these levels if the Fed didn't feed companies by buying their bonds with stimulus (money created out of thin air). Share buybacks were mostly funded by Fed stimulus and one of main reasons why the market kept going up throughout the pandemic. You can do the math. $120 billion of stimulus per month x two years = over $2 trillion in stimulus being injected indirectly into the markets.
